Abstract: A multi-layer video decoder is configured to determine, based on a list of triplet entries, whether the multi-layer video decoder is capable of decoding a bitstream that comprises an encoded representation of the multi-layer video data. The number of triplet entries in the list is equal to a number of single-layer decoders in the multi-layer video decoder. Each respective triplet entry in the list of triplet entries indicates a profile, a tier, and a level for a respective single-layer decoder in the multi-layer video decoder. The multi-layer video decoder is configured such that, based on the multi-layer video decoder being capable of decoding the bitstream, the multi-layer video decoder decodes the bitstream.

Abstract: A video coding device, such as a video encoder or a video decoder, may be configured to decode a duration between coded picture buffer (CPB) removal time of a first decoding unit (DU) in an access unit (AU) and CPB removal time of a second DU, wherein the first DU comprises a non-video coding layer (VCL) network abstraction layer (NAL) unit with nal_unit_type equal to UNSPEC0, EOS_NUT, EOB_NUT, in the range of RSV_NVCL44 to RSV_NVCL47 or in the range of UNSPEC48 to UNSPEC63. The video decoder determines a removal time of the first DU based at least in part on the decoded duration and decodes video data of the first DU based at least in part on the removal time.

Abstract: Bitstream restrictions or constraints on the partitioning of pictures across layers of video data are described. In some examples, the number of tiles per picture for each layer of a plurality of layers is constrained based on a maximum number of tiles per picture for the layer. In some examples, the number of tiles per picture for each layer of the plurality of layers is no greater than the maximum number of tiles per picture for the layer. In some examples, a sum of the numbers of tiles per picture for the plurality of layers is no greater than a sum of the maximum numbers of tiles per picture for the plurality of layers. In some examples, a second largest coding unit (LCU) or coding tree block (CTB) size for a second layer is constrained based on, e.g., to be equal to, a first LCU size for a first layer.

Abstract: A computing device generates a file that comprises a track box that contains metadata for a track in the file. Media data for the track comprises a sequence of samples, each of the samples being a video access unit of multi-layer video data. As part of generating the file, the computing device generates, in the file, a sub-sample information box that contains flags that specify a type of sub-sample information given in the sub-sample information box. When the flags have a particular value, a sub-sample corresponding to the sub-sample information box contains exactly one coded picture and zero or more non-Video Coding Layer (VCL) Network Abstraction Layer (NAL) units associated with the coded picture.
